/***Scott Bisset CSS***/

* {margin: 0; padding: 0}

body {background-color:#e0f2f7; color:#333;   height:auto !important;	width:100%; margin:0 auto;}


.back { background:#e0f2f7 url(/assets/templates/scotbis/images/back-repeat.jpg); background-repeat:repeat-x;background-position:top; }

.logo {background:url(/assets/templates/scotbis/images/logo.jpg); height:244px; background-repeat:no-repeat; width:960px; margin:0px auto; }


.logoAlt {background:url(/assets/templates/scotbis/images/logoAlt.jpg); height:277px; background-repeat:no-repeat; width:960px; margin:0px auto; }



.body-repeat {background:url(/assets/templates/scotbis/images/body-repeat.jpg); background-repeat:repeat-y; width:960px; margin:0px auto; padding-top:0px; 
-moz-border-radius:10px; 
-webkit-border-radius:10px;
 }

.Content {color:#666;
font-family:Helvetica,Arial,sans-serif;
font-size:small;
line-height:25px;
padding:0px 15px;
min-height:500px;
text-align:justify;
margin-left:30px;
}

.footer {background:url(/assets/templates/scotbis/images/footer.jpg); background-repeat:no-repeat;height:50px; width:960px; margin:0px auto;}

.footerList a {color:#52a8c8; font-weight:bold; text-decoration:none}

.footerList {width:525px}

.indent {color:#999999;
float:right; margin-top:10px;
margin-right:73px;font-family:Helvetica,Arial,sans-serif;
}
.Noindent {text-indent:0px}

img, fieldset {border:0px}


.clearfix {clear:both}

.floatleft {float:left}
.floatright {float:right}

.rightbar {background:#52A8C8; color:#eeeeee; -moz-border-radius-bottomright:10px; 
-webkit-border-bottom-right-radius:10px;
-moz-border-radius-bottomleft:10px; 
-webkit-border-bottom-left-radius:10px;
}

.topQuote {color:#555555;
font-size:1em;
font-weight:bold;
left:0;
line-height:30px;
margin:0 auto;
padding-right:390px;
position:absolute;
right:0;
text-align:justify;
top:79px;height:100px;
width:447px;}

/* GENERIC text settings */

.xsmallText {font-size:x-small}
.smallText {font-size:small}
.mediumText {font-size:medium}
.largeText {font-size:large}
.xlargeText {font-size:x-large}
.nounderlineText {text-decoration:none}

.lineHeight25 {line-height:25px}
.lineHeight30 {line-height:30px}
.lineHeight35 {line-height:35px}
.lineHeight50 {line-height:50px}
.lineHeight65 {line-height:65px}

.orangeText {color:#E55700}
.yellowText {color:#ffff00}
.blueText {color:#476C8E}
.redText {color:#ff0000}
.whiteText {color:#ffffff}
.textwhite {color:#eeeeee}
.boldText {font-weight:bold}
.pointerText {cursor:pointer}
.pageTitleText {padding:5px; background:#E55700; color:#eeeeee; -moz-border-radius-topright:5px; -moz-border-radius-topleft:5px; 
-webkit-border-top-left-radius:10px; -webkit-border-top-right-radius:5px;}


.pageTitleText a:link{color:#444;}
.pageTitleText a:hover{color:#222;}
.pageTitleText a:visited{color:#444;}

.rightText {text-align:right}
.leftText {text-align:left}
.centerText {text-align:center}
/* END GENERIC text settings */

.listNone {list-style:none}
.listSquare {list-style:square}

.floatleft {float:left}
.floatright {float:right}

.width150 {width:150px}
.width200 {width:200px}
.width230 {width:230px}
.width250 {width:250px}
.width300 {width:300px}
.width400 {width:400px}
.width500 {width:500px}
.width550 {width:550px}
.width600 {width:600px}



.padding5 {padding:5px}
.padding10 {padding:10px}
.padding20 {padding:20px}
.paddingNoTop {padding-top:0px}

.left100 {padding-left:100px}
.left50 {padding-left:50px}
.left40 {padding-left:40px}
.left30 {padding-left:30px}
.left20 {padding-left:20px}
.left18 {padding-left:18px}
.left10 {padding-left:10px}

.marginleft100 {margin-left:100px}
.marginleft50 {margin-left:50px}
.marginleft40 {margin-left:40px}
.marginleft30 {margin-left:30px}
.marginleft20 {margin-left:20px}
.marginleft10 {margin-left:10px}

.right100 {padding-right:100px}
.right50 {padding-right:50px}
.right40 {padding-right:40px}
.right30 {padding-right:30px}
.right20 {padding-right:20px}
.right10 {padding-right:10px}

.top10 {padding-top:10px}
.top20 {padding-top:20px}
.top30 {padding-top:30px}
.top35 {padding-top:35px}
.top40 {padding-top:40px}
.top50 {padding-top:50px}
.top50 {padding-top:50px}
.top100 {padding-top:100px}

.bottom10 {padding-bottom:10px}
.bottom20 {padding-bottom:20px}
.bottom30 {padding-bottom:30px}
.bottom40 {padding-bottom:40px}
.bottom100 {padding-bottom:100px}


.lineHeight20 {line-height:20px}
.lineHeight25 {line-height:25px}
.lineHeight30 {line-height:30px}
.lineHeight50 {line-height:50px}
.lineHeight70 {line-height:70px}

.listNone {list-style:none}
.listArrow {list-style-image:url(/assets/templates/nat/images/arrow.png);}
.listArrowLeft {
height:39px;
text-align:center;
margin-top:6px;
}

.centerText {text-align:center}
.justifyText {text-align:justify}
.leftText {text-align:left}
.rightText {text-align:right}
.boldText {font-weight:bold}

.smallText {font-size:small}
.mediumText {font-size:medium}
.largeText {font-size:large}
.xlargeText {font-size:x-large}

.purpleText {color:#900a67}
.orangeText {color:#EF962C}
.whiteText {color:#ffffff}

.marginCenter {margin:0px auto}

#tweener .inputback {
	background:#ffffff;
	border:2px solid #cccccc;
	padding:10px;
	-moz-border-radius:10px;
	-webkit-border-radius : 10px;
	width:300px;
	color:#333;
	font-weight:bold;
	font-size:large
}

#tweenerBookme .inputback {
	background:#ffffff;
	border:2px solid #cccccc;
	padding:5px;
	-moz-border-radius:10px;
	-webkit-border-radius : 10px;
	width:200px;
	color:#333;
	font-weight:bold;
	font-size:large; line-height:35px
}

.button { margin-left:60px}

.button-holder {background:none repeat scroll 0 0 #52A8C8;
height:50px;
margin-left:18px;
margin-top:228px;
position:absolute;
text-indent:0;
width:925px;}

.button-holder ul {list-style:none}

.button-holder ul li {float:left;}

.button-holder ul li .text {padding-top:0px; }

.listArrowLeft a {position:relative;
top:10px;
}

.button-holder ul li a {font-weight:bold; text-decoration:none; color:#eeeeee; font-size:medium;}

.button-holder ul li a:hover {font-weight:bold; text-decoration:none; color:#ccc; font-size:medium; }

.adholder {
bottom:0;
height:86px;
list-style:none outside none;
margin-left:90%;
margin-right:50px;
overflow:hidden;
position:relative;width:100px;
}

.tipz {
font-weight:bold;
text-align:center;
}

#overlay {margin: 0px auto; top:25%; 	-moz-border-radius:10px;
	-webkit-border-radius : 10px; display:hidden; top:-2000px; position:fixed; left:0; right:0; margin:0px auto; width:830px; height:500px} 

.close {background:url(http://www.theclubedinburgh.co.uk/assets/js/lightbox/closebox.png) no-repeat scroll center center transparent;
border:medium none;display:block;
height:30px;
width:30px;
z-index:999}

#map {margin: 0px auto;  	-moz-border-radius:10px;
	-webkit-border-radius : 10px;} 

.hidden {display:none}

.maplink ul {list-style:none}
.sitemap ul {list-style:none; line-height:40px; margin-left:50px; margin-top:50px}
.sitemap ul li a {text-decoration:none; font-size:1.5em; color:#52A8C8 }
